An engineer is configuring Packet Buffer Protection on ingress zones to protect from single-session DoS attacks. Which sessions does Packet Buffer Protection apply to?
Answer options
- A. It applies to existing sessions and is not global
- B. It applies to existing sessions and is global
- C. It applies to new sessions and is global
- D. It applies to new sessions and is not global
Correct answer: B
Explanation
The correct answer is B because Packet Buffer Protection is designed to apply to existing sessions and is implemented globally across the system. Options A, C, and D are incorrect as they misstate the scope of application or the type of sessions affected by the protection mechanism.
